Hi Jacobko
Looks like you have found some one who is interested in your Nada 6 cylinder, glad to see it will be potentially reused and not scraped like most of them.
Rovers North Forum has a on going list of all the remaining NADAs that is kind of interesting to read.
I have a very complete Nada Dormobile # 800 the engine needed a complete rebuild (it ran when I got it last fall but not well).
Just to let you know engine parts are still available a lot of the 6 cylinder parts from most of the usual Land rover parts places, some of the items specific to the NADA high performance engine are very hard to find.
I did source NADA parts from 2 companies in Britain, Turner engineering and John Wearing rover parts but sit down when you get a price quote, this has been the most expensive engine rebuild I have ever done ever.
Good luck to both of you hope to see it on the road one day.
